Operating Manual Part 2 summary
Staying up late is a kind of self-rescue, a way to guard the only hours where the daily battle is called off. But this late-night freedom borrows against tomorrow's reserves, making the next day feel even louder and more terrifying, which drives my need to escape again. I am realizing I don't have a discipline problem—I have just been putting out fires with gasoline because it was the only thing within reach. My body actually already knows how to find true calm through focused attention, emotional release, and self-witnessing, and the key out of this loop starts with one small morning move.
